Responsibilities

  • Provides care in a fast-paced, high acuity environment that acts similarly to an advanced urgent care with Physician oversight.
  • Patient population will include ages >1 year of age to geriatrics.
  • Care will include a large variety of chief complaints.
  • Serves in an expanded role and prioritizes tasks and uses critical thinking and clinical judgment to provide urgent care.
  • Work collaboratively with provider to triage patient care needs, assess patient needs, plan, and provide nursing care and coordinate follow-up care.
  • Exhibits compassionate care during patient-nurse interactions.
  • Coordinates patient care and interaction of staff.
  • Obtains and documents patient medical history, chief complaint, vital signs, and provides basic medical data base for provider, and prepares patient for examinations.
  • Performs initial and ongoing patient assessment.
  • Evaluates effectiveness of nursing interventions and revises plan of care based upon patient response to interventions.
  • Observes, reports, interprets, and records manifestations of the patient’s condition.
  • Provides direct patient care including, treatments, medications, and diagnostic studies according to policy and procedure.
  • Assists provider in performance of procedures as directed by provider to facilitate accurate diagnosis.
  • Inserts, monitors, regulates, and discontinues IVs as required by provider.
  • Collects and prepares laboratory specimens and completes associated paperwork to expedite laboratory studies with maximum accuracy and efficiency.
  • Communicates with lab, radiology, and other testing results to patients and via telephone and electronic medical record letter notification.
  • Formulates, coordinates, and provides plan of care as established in department standards including, patient and family education, family needs and discharge planning throughout office visit.
  • Actively participates as a team member working toward team goals of the department and organization and is accountable for unit and system specific metrics.
  • Provides instruction to ensure patient's understanding of medical condition and compliance with treatment instructions.
